Transgender swimmer Lia Thomas insisted in an interview Tuesday that athletes like her “are not a threat to women’s sports” — while revealing that she now has her eye on the Olympics.“I knew there would be scrutiny against me if I competed as a woman, and I was prepared for that,” the 22-year-old Texan told “Good Morning America” in her first TV interview about the controversy sparked by her record-breaking performances in the pool.“But I also don’t need anybody’s permission to be myself and to do the sport that I love,” she said defiantly.
